Description Lagged tells the story of a boy convicted as a pick- pocket in London in 1792 and transported to Botany Bay for seven years. Consists entirely of graphics from the period using sepia-tint photographs and contemporary ballads and suggests that a convict in Australia was better off than a coal miner in England, at least up to 1836.
